The Canadian Children's Book Centre is excited to announce the title for the 2022 TD Grade One Book Giveaway. Fast Friends, written by Heather M. O’Connor, illustrated by Claudia Dávila, and published by Scholastic Canada, will be distributed to over 550,000 Grade 1 students in fall 2022.
In this fun and heartwarming story of friendship and overcoming obstacles, Suze, a nonverbal child, is introduced to high-energy Tyson’s class. At first, everyone is tentative about him being around her but while the other students and even the teacher don’t understand Suze, Tyson does. Tyson and Suze have more in common than anyone thought and they become Fast Friends.
Fast Friends will be distributed through school boards, library organizations and ministries of education to every Grade 1 child in Canada, including those in remote areas and Indigenous communities. For children with print disabilities, there will be an option for an ebook version with image descriptions or a print braille edition of the title.
Administered by the Canadian Children’s Book Centre and through the generous support of TD Bank Group, every year the TD Grade One Book Giveaway gives the gift of a great Canadian children’s picture book to every Grade 1 student in Canada. Working with ministries of education, school boards and library organizations, the CCBC distributes over 550,000 giveaway books annually. Since 2000, over 12 million books have been given to Grade 1 students across Canada. For many children, this will be the first book they have ever owned.

About The Canadian Children’s Book Centre:
The Canadian Children’s Book Centre is a national, not-for-profit organization founded in 1976. We are dedicated to encouraging, promoting and supporting the reading, writing and illustrating of Canadian books for young readers. Our programs, publications and resources help teachers, librarians, booksellers and parents select the very best for young readers.
